Understanding Headphone Prices: A Comprehensive Guide
In the ever-evolving landscape of audio technology, headphones have actually ended up being a necessary device for music lovers, gamers, and experts. They are available in various styles, each with special functions catering to different needs and choices. Nevertheless, among the most vital elements that affect a consumer's choice is price. This post aims to explore the elements influencing headphone rates, use insights on pricing tiers, and provide a list of popular headphone designs across different price ranges.
Aspects Influencing Headphone Prices
Several crucial factors impact the price of headphones, that include:
1. Type of Headphones
- Over-Ear: Known for their comfort and sound quality, over-ear headphones generally vary from mid to high price points.
- On-Ear: These use a more portable alternative and normally sit at a lower price compared to over-ear choices.
- In-Ear: Also referred to as earphones, these are normally more cost effective, however high-end models can be costly.
- True Wireless: TWS headphones have gotten appeal for their benefit however can vary significantly in cost.
2. Brand name Reputation
- Brand names like Bose and Sennheiser command greater costs due to their established reputation and quality control, while lesser-known brand names might offer more budget friendly alternatives without significant brand backing.
3. Sound Quality
- Headphones with much better motorists and advanced sound innovations, such as sound cancellation or adaptive noise settings, come at a premium price.
4. Material and Build Quality
- Headphones made from long lasting products like metal and premium plastics are usually more pricey due to the increased production cost.
5. Functions
- Wired vs. Wireless: Wireless headphones typically cost more due to Bluetooth technology and battery management systems.
- Sound Cancellation: Active noise cancellation innovation substantially increases the price of headphones.
- Microphone Quality: Integrated top quality microphones improve functionality, particularly for gamers and professionals, resulting in a higher price.
6. Target Audience
- Headphones developed for audiophiles or professional studio use normally fall within a higher price bracket due to precision engineering and premium products.
Headphones Pricing Tiers
When shopping for headphones, it can be useful to categorize them into unique prices tiers. Below is a breakdown of prices tiers and examples of popular headphone designs in each classification.
Price Range | Description | Example Models |
---|---|---|
Budget plan (<<₤ 50)Basic features, good quality, suitable for casual usage. | Anker SoundCore, JLab Audio | |
Mid-range (₤ 50 - ₤ 150) | Balanced sound quality, more convenience, extra functions like sound seclusion. | Sony WH-CH710N, Apple AirPods |
High-end (₤ 150 - ₤ 300) | Superior sound quality, exceptional develop quality, functions like noise cancellation. | Bose QuietComfort 35 II, Sennheiser HD 558 |
Audiophile (₤ 300+) | Exceptional audio fidelity, frequently including high-end materials and innovations. | Audeze LCD-X, Focal Stellia |
Move Beyond Price Tags: An In-depth Comparison
For customers considering their headphone purchase beyond just price, comprehending the benefits and prospective downsides of each classification is necessary. Here's how they compare to one another:
Budget Headphones
- Pros: Affordable, good sound quality for daily tasks, light-weight.
- Cons: Durability concerns, minimal functions, poorer sound quality compared to more pricey designs.
Mid-range Headphones
- Pros: Great balance of price and performance, additional functions like better cushioning and sound seclusion.
- Cons: May still do not have the sound quality of higher-end options.
High-End Headphones
- Pros: Outstanding sound quality, high comfort levels, flexible functions like sound cancellation.
- Cons: Price can be excessively high for casual listeners.
Audiophile
- Pros: Exceptional sound recreation, premium materials, focused on producing an immersive listening experience.
- Cons: Not suitable for casual listeners due to high price; might require extra amplifications.
Often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. Why are some headphones so costly?
Expensive headphones frequently include high-quality materials, advanced innovations, remarkable sound engineering, and reputable brand backing. Audiophiles and experts may discover these features worth the financial investment.
2. Are more affordable headphones worth buying?
Less expensive headphones can be a good alternative for casual users or those simply beginning with headphones. They typically supply decent sound quality for everyday usage however might do not have toughness and advanced features.
3. Do I require sound cancellation for routine use?
If you frequently find yourself in noisy environments or commute regularly, noise cancellation can enhance your listening experience. Nevertheless, if you normally utilize headphones in quieter settings, it may not be necessary.
